Output 70aefba85cc73776a070ccc3f36f64a6bbabbb903270a8b3bd7e6e8e07038e57:0

value
66224509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f219d5dc12744f9f63bf6ac85e4bd11861b916b OP_EQUAL
address
MDey578x5JB9x2o4FSC4sPKBNDT6aLPReT
transaction
70aefba85cc73776a070ccc3f36f64a6bbabbb903270a8b3bd7e6e8e07038e57
spent
true